Understanding the Huawei Y5 Battery Capacity
The Huawei Y5 series comes with a range of battery capacities, depending on the specific model. The latest Huawei Y5 (2022) model boasts a 5000mAh battery, while the Huawei Y5p (2020) has a slightly smaller 4000mAh battery. The battery capacity is a crucial factor in determining the overall battery life of the device.
How Battery Capacity Affects Battery Life
A higher battery capacity generally translates to longer battery life, but it’s not the only factor at play. Other elements, such as screen size, resolution, and processor efficiency, also impact battery performance. The Huawei Y5’s battery capacity is designed to provide a full day’s use, but actual battery life may vary depending on individual usage patterns.

Factors Affecting Huawei Y5 Battery Life
Several factors can impact the Huawei Y5 battery life, including:
Screen Brightness and Resolution
- A brighter screen and higher resolution can significantly reduce battery life.
- Adjusting the screen brightness and resolution can help extend battery life.
Network and Connectivity
- Poor network connectivity and frequent switching between Wi-Fi and mobile data can drain the battery faster.
- Enabling power-saving features like low-power mode and adaptive brightness can help mitigate this issue.
Apps and Background Processes
- Resource-intensive apps and background processes can consume battery power even when not in use.
- Closing unused apps and disabling background processes can help conserve battery life.
Charging Habits
- Frequent charging and discharging can affect battery health and lifespan.
- Avoiding overcharging and keeping the battery level between 20% and 80% can help maintain battery health.

Model | Battery Capacity | Screen Size | Processor |
---|---|---|---|
Huawei Y5 (2022) | 5000mAh | 6.52 inches | MediaTek Helio P35 |
Huawei Y5p (2020) | 4000mAh | 5.71 inches | MediaTek Helio P22 |

How long does it take to fully charge the Huawei Y5’s battery?
The Huawei Y5 supports 10W charging, which is relatively fast compared to other devices in its class. According to Huawei’s official specifications, it takes approximately 2.5 hours to fully charge the battery from 0 to 100%. However, this charging time may vary depending on the charger and cable used, as well as the device’s usage patterns.
It’s worth noting that the Huawei Y5 also supports power-saving features, such as low-power mode and ultra-power-saving mode, which can help extend battery life when the device is running low on power. These features can be enabled manually or set to turn on automatically when the battery level falls below a certain threshold.
